Frequently Asked Questions

What are the key improvements in the Smith & Wesson Bodyguard 2.0?

The S&W Bodyguard 2.0 transitions to a striker-fired system, offers significantly increased magazine capacity (10 and 12 rounds), and features an enhanced grip texture and improved trigger reset, making it more shootable than its predecessor.

How does .380 ACP perform in self-defense ballistics compared to .22 LR?

Ballistics tests show .380 ACP rounds, like Federal HST, expand significantly and transfer more energy, causing greater internal damage. .22 LR penetrates but lacks expansion, making it less effective for stopping threats.

Can small .380 ACP pistols be accurate at longer distances?

Yes, the S&W Bodyguard 2.0 demonstrated surprising accuracy for a micro-compact .380, with the host successfully hitting steel targets at distances up to 140 yards, proving their potential beyond close quarters.

What is the most important safety tip for pocket carrying a firearm?

The most critical safety tip for pocket carry is to always use a proper holster. This prevents accidental discharges, protects the trigger, and ensures a safe and efficient draw when needed.
